I booked my ticket the day they came on sale (26 February) and therefore was only 5 rows away from the stage - this is essential if you wish to take some half decent concert photography. I got away with my Nikon D80 (SLR!) and used it to my hearts content. The light levels were quite low at times, especially on the singer's faces and I wasn't going to increase my ISO above 320 (as it degrades the image considereably). I'd rather underexpose using a low ISO and increase the exposure in photoshop - not ideal either but concert photography is all about compromise - and fast shutter speeds are definitely not an option unless you have a very expensive camera.
Anyway, this is a Morten Harket. Yes this was the colour of the lighting (and not very bright either), I'd underexposed it and increased the exposure in photoshop by about 4 stops!
